About Crispy Potato and Pea Tikkis: A Delicious Indian Snack Recipe

These Crispy Potato and Pea Tikkis are a delightful Indian snack, perfect for a quick and tasty evening treat or appetizer. The combination of spiced potatoes and peas, encased in a crispy breadcrumb coating, delivers a satisfying crunch with every bite.
This recipe is easy to follow, even for beginner cooks, and offers a delicious vegetarian option that's sure to impress your family and friends. Get ready to experience a flavor explosion that will leave you wanting more!

Instructions
 

Prepare the Potato Filling

  • Heat 1 tablespoon of oil in a pan. Add cumin seeds and let them splutter. Add chopped ginger and sauté for 30 seconds. Add peas, potatoes, salt, red chili powder, coriander powder, and amchur powder. Cook for 5-7 minutes, mashing the potatoes slightly to create a soft mixture. Let cool completely.

Make the Batter

  • In a bowl, whisk together cornflour, rice flour, and a pinch of salt with enough water to create a thin, smooth batter.

Assemble and Shape the Tikkis

  • Lightly moisten each bread slice. Place a spoonful of the potato mixture in the center, shape it into a small patty or tikki, and flatten slightly. Refrigerate for at least 15 minutes to firm up.

Fry the Tikkis

  • Heat 2-3 tablespoons of oil in a pan over medium heat. Dip each tikki in the batter, ensuring it’s fully coated. Carefully place the tikkis in the hot oil and shallow fry until golden brown and crispy on both sides.

Garnish and Serve

  • Sprinkle sesame seeds on top of the cooked tikkis. Serve hot with your favorite chutney or dipping sauce.

Recipe Notes

Expert Tips for the Perfect Crispy Potato and Pea Tikkis

  • For extra crispy tikkis, you can double-dip them in the batter.
  • Don't overcrowd the pan while frying; fry in batches to ensure even browning and crispiness.
  • Adjust the amount of red chili powder to your preference. You can add a pinch of garam masala for a deeper, more complex flavor.
  • If you don't have amchur powder, you can substitute it with a little lemon juice for a tangy twist.
